1) [CoCl4]-2  + 6H2O <------------> [ Co(H2O)6]+2   + 4Cl-

blue pink

When water is added , the equilibrium shifts right side , so the pink color is observed.

When NaCl is added , the equilibrium shifts left side , so the blue color is observed.
